1791 Princess Diamond Ring Review
This multistone diamond engagement ring design showcases the fabulous sparkle of the princess cut. It features a gorgeous princess cut diamond for the centre stone as well as princess cut diamonds channel set into the ring's band for added brilliance.
The princess cut diamond is a popular choice for diamond engagement rings. The cut was designed specifically to maximise the diamonds' brilliance and this is used to maximum effect in this design by 1791 Diamonds' Head Designer, Alice Herald. The square cut of the princess diamond allows the side stones to be set side by side with little or no gap, creating the impression of a glittering ribbon laid along the ring's band.
As well as fabulous sparkle, there are other advantages to choosing a princess cut for a diamond engagement ring. Inclusions (flaws) are less visible with this cut, and any slight yellowish colour is less noticeable than with other cuts.
